It isn't the official document, but at least it's accessible. Netgear (among other manufacturers) licenses ZyXEL's embedded OS for their router hardware. It includes a command-line interface which is otherwise undocumented. I tried spelunking around ZyXEL's website looking for it and got bupkis, squared. Luckily for me, a quick Google search turned up a useful annotated cheat sheet. Even with these clues, by the way, ZyXEL's website is less than spectactularly useful.
